Expression• An expression is any valid set of literals, variables, operators, function calls, and
expressions that evaluates to a single value.• The resulting single value can be a number, a string, a Boolean, or a special value (null,
undefined, Infinity, or NaN); that is, the result of any expression is always one of JS’s defined data types or special values.
3 + 7 // number 103 + 7 + 10 + "" // string 20"Dr. " + " " + "Pepper" // string Dr. Pepper
• Literal is a “simple expression”:1.7 (number literal)"JS" (string literal)true (Boolean literal)null (special value){ x:2, y:2} (object literal)[2,3,4,5,6] (array literal)function (x) { return x * x; } (function leteral)

• A statement is any set of declarations, method calls, function calls, and expressions that performs some action.
var num = 1; // declare a variabledocument.write("hello"); // perform write action
• Statement end with (;)
Expressions vs Statements• Statements often contain expressions that have to be evaluated before the
specified action can be performed.
document.write("Sum: ", 3 + 7, "<br>"); // write statement with expression
1. Evaluates the expression 3 + 72. Writes the string "Sum: "3. Converts the number 10 to a string and writes it4. Finally, writes the string "<br>"
total = 1 + 2; // assignment statement with expression
1. Evaluates the expression 1 + 22. Assigns to variable - total
NOTE: all JS values can be classified as one of the three primitive data types or one of the special values null, undefined, Infinity, or NaN.
Expression Satements• Assignment statements are one major category of
expression statements:s = "Hello " + name;i *= 3;
• The increment and decrement operators, ++ and --, are related to assignment statements:
counter++;
• Function calls are another major category of expression statements:
alert("Welcome, " + name);window.close();
Compound Statements• JavaScript has a way to combine a number of
statements into a single statement (or statement block):
{x = Math.PI;cx = Math.cos(x);alert("cos(" + x + ") = " + cx);
}
• This statement block acts as a single statement, it does not end with a semicolon. The primitive statements within the block end in semicolons, but the block itself does not.

Types of Operators• JS supports five categories of operators:
String operator – operators that work on strings Arithmetic operators, or mathematical operators – operators that
perform mathematical computations Assignment operators – operators that assign a value to a variable,
object, or property Comparison operators – operators that compare two values or
expressions and return a Boolean value indicating true or false Logical operators, or Boolean operators – operators that take Boolean
values as operands and return a Boolean value indicating the true or false of the relationship.
• In addition, JS supports one special operator, the conditional operator.
String Operator (concatenation)• There are only two string operators: the concatenation operator (+) and the
concatenation by value operator (+=).
• The concatenation operator (+) concatenates two strings together."Greetings, " + "everyone" // Evaluating to the string "Greetings, everyone"var salutation = "Greetings, ";var recipient = "everyone";salutation + recipient; // "Greetings, everyone“
• The concatenation by value (+=) concatenates the string on the right side to the string value stored in the variable on the left side, then assigns the result back to the left operand variable.
var greeting = "Greetings, ";greeting += "everyone"; // Then, greeting will gets “Greetings, everyone”
• NOTE: a common use of the concatenation by value operator (+=) is to pile a bunch of HTML statements into a single string variable for easy writing to a pop-up window.

Comparison Operators• Comparison operators compares two values or two expressions of any
data type. • Usually, the two items being compared are of the same data type. • The result of a comparison is always a Boolean truth value: true or false.• JS often performs conversions for you when you do comparisons of strings
and numbers.• All comparisons except (===) and (!==), JS assumes you are trying to
compare similar data type and performs the conversions for you.5 == "5" // true
NOTE: JS converts the string to a number in order to perform a meaningful comparison. (numbers had already represented in float, so perform a parseFloat() to string)

Logical (Boolean) Operators
• Logical operations, AKA, Boolean operations, always result in a truth value: true or false.
• The && (AND) operator: In order for an && (AND) expression to be true, both operands must be true.
• The || (OR) operator: only one side needs to be true in order for the expression to evaluate to true.
• The ! (NOT) operator: negate the expression

The Conditional Operator
• The conditional operator is the only JS operator that takes three operands.
• The syntax is (condition) ? ValueIfTrue : ValueIfFalse ;
var age = 38;status = (age >= 18) ? "adult" : "minor" ;
NOTE: status = "adult" ("adult" will be assigned to the variable status.)

Special Operator (delete)• JS supports several special operators that you should be aware of: delete, new, this, typeof, and
void• delete operator: allows you to delete an array entry or an object from memory.• delete is a unary operator that attempts to delete property, array element, or variable specified as
its operand.• Not all variables and properties can be deleted: built-in core and client-side properties, and user-
defined variables declared with the var statement cannot be deleted.var obj = { x:1, y:2 }; // defined an objectdelete obj.x; // delete property, return truetypeof obj.x; // property not exist, undefineddelete obj.x; // nonexist property, return truedelete obj; // cannot delete var defined, return falsex = 1; // no var defineddelete x; // ok to del, not defined with var, true
• When remove an element from an array with the delete operator, JS does not collapse the array. In stead, that array element becomes undefined; any attempt to evaluate that element results in undefined.
Special Operator (new)• The Object-Creation Operator (new): creates a new object and invokes
a constructor function to initialize it.• It is a unary operator.
new constructor(arguments); constructor must be an expression that evaluates to a constructor
function.var obj = new Object; // omit ()var curDate = new Date();var myArray = new Array();
• If the function call has no arguments, JS allows the parentheses to be omitted

Special Operator (typeof)
• The typeof operator: is a unary operator that determines the current data type of any variable.
• The result of a typeof operation is : number, string, boolean, object, or undefined.
• typeof (operand)• Or typeof operand• NOTE: parentheses are optional. but it is considered
good programming style to use them.
Special Operator (void)• The void operator: is a unary operator that tells the
interpreter to evaluate an expression and returns no value (return undefined).
• The most common use for this operator is in JS Pseudo-protocol, where it allows you to evaluate an expression for its side effects without the browser displaying the value of the evaluated expression:
<a href="javascript: void window.open();">New window</a>
